California Legislators Announce Essay and Visual Arts Scholarships to Raise Awareness of the Armenian Genocide
The California Armenian Legislative Caucus is holding two scholarship contests for the 2018 commemoration of the Armenian Genocide. California high school students in 9th through 12th grade are invited to participate in an essay contest and/or a visual arts contest to increase greater awareness of the Armenian Genocide on its anniversary.
Registration Opens for $3,000 Seismic Retrofit Grants
Earthquake Brace + Bolt available to more homeowners in more California cities
SACRAMENTO, Calif, Jan. 23, 2018—Registration opens today for eligible homeowners to receive grants of up to $3,000 for seismic retrofits of their older homes, making them more resistant to earthquake damage.

Assemblymember Nazarian Secures $3.7 Million for the United States only Parkinson’s Disease Registry in the 2017 - 18 Assembly & Senate Budget Proposal
(Sacramento, CA) Assemblymember Adrin Nazarian (D-Sherman Oaks) secured $3.7 million to fund a Parkinson’s disease registry in California. AB 2248, passed in 2004 established the Parkinson’s disease registry modeled after the world renowned California Cancer Registry. The Parkinson’s disease registry has never been funded.
